The Origins and History of Terracotta Jewellery

Terracotta jewellery has a rich history that dates back thousands of years. It originated in ancient civilizations such as Mesopotamia, Egypt, and the Indus Valley. The word “terracotta” comes from the Italian words “terra” meaning earth and “cotta” meaning cooked. This refers to the process of firing clay to create durable and beautiful jewellery pieces.

In ancient times, terracotta jewellery was made by hand using clay found in the local environment. Artisans would shape the clay into various forms, such as beads, pendants, and bangles. These pieces would then be dried in the sun and fired in kilns to harden them.

Terracotta jewellery has been a significant part of various cultures throughout history. In ancient Egypt, it was worn by both men and women as a symbol of status and protection. The Egyptians believed that terracotta had protective qualities and brought good luck.

In the Indus Valley civilization, terracotta jewellery was adorned with intricate designs and patterns. It was often used as a form of self-expression and a way to showcase one’s creativity. The unique craftsmanship and attention to detail made these pieces highly sought after.

Over time, terracotta jewellery spread across different regions and evolved with the influence of various cultures. In India, terracotta jewellery became popular during the Indus Valley civilization and continues to be a significant part of traditional attire in many states.

Today, terracotta jewellery is cherished for its natural beauty, simplicity, and eco-friendly nature. It is often handmade by skilled artisans who use traditional techniques passed down through generations. The earthy tones and rustic appeal of terracotta jewellery make it a versatile accessory that can be paired with both traditional and contemporary outfits.

Craftsmanship and Design

Terracotta jewellery is a beautiful form of wearable art that exemplifies the perfect blend of craftsmanship and design. Craftsmanship refers to the skill and expertise involved in creating a piece, while design focuses on the aesthetic appeal and concept behind it. When it comes to terracotta jewellery, both of these elements are crucial in producing exquisite pieces that captivate the wearer and onlookers alike.

Craftsmanship plays a vital role in the creation of terracotta jewellery. Skilled artisans meticulously handcraft each piece, paying attention to every detail. The process involves shaping the clay, either by hand or using molds, and then drying and firing it to achieve the desired hardness and durability. It requires precision and patience to create beautiful patterns, intricate carvings, and delicate textures on the terracotta surface. The expertise of these artisans ensures that each piece is unique and possesses a distinct charm.

Sustainability and Eco-Friendliness

Terracotta jewellery is an excellent choice for individuals who are concerned about sustainability and eco-friendliness. Made from natural clay, terracotta jewellery is not only beautiful but also environmentally friendly. Here are some reasons why terracotta jewellery online promotes sustainability and eco-friendliness:

Use of Natural Resources:  Making Terracotta jewellery starts with natural clay.  This is abundant and easily accessible. Unlike other forms of jewellery that require mining precious metals or gemstones, terracotta jewellery utilizes clay that can be found in the earth’s crust. This reduces the need for extensive mining operations, which can have detrimental effects on the environment.

Biodegradability: Terracotta jewellery is biodegradable, meaning it can decompose naturally without causing harm to the environment. When discarded, terracotta jewellery will not contribute to landfills or pollution. This makes it a sustainable choice as it does not leave a lasting impact on the planet.

Handmade Craftsmanship: Terracotta jewellery is often handcrafted by skilled artisans. This traditional technique not only preserves cultural heritage but also supports local communities. By purchasing terracotta jewellery online, you are supporting sustainable livelihoods and helping to preserve traditional craftsmanship.

Low Energy Consumption: The production of terracotta jewellery requires minimal energy compared to other forms of jewellery manufacturing processes. The clay is shaped, dried, and kiln-fired, which consumes less energy compared to the energy-intensive processes involved in mining and refining precious metals.

Versatility and Durability: You can design Terracotta jewellery in various shapes, sizes, and colors, offering a wide range of options for consumers. Its durability ensures that it can be worn for a long time without losing its charm. By investing in long-lasting terracotta jewellery, you reduce the need for frequent replacements, thereby reducing waste.

Care and Maintenance

Terracotta jewellery is a popular choice for many people who appreciate its unique and earthy charm. To ensure that your terracotta jewellery online stays in good condition and maintains its beauty, it is important to provide proper care and maintenance. Here are some tips to help you take care of your terracotta jewellery:

  • Avoid exposing your terracotta jewellery to water or any liquids, as this can cause the clay to soften and lose its shape.
  • Store your terracotta jewellery in a dry and cool place, away from direct sunlight, to prevent fading or discoloration.
  • Handle your terracotta jewellery with care, as it can be fragile and prone to breakage. Avoid dropping or knocking it against hard surfaces.
  • Clean your terracotta jewellery gently using a soft cloth or brush to remove any dust or dirt. Avoid using harsh chemicals or cleaners that may damage the clay.
  • Consider applying a thin layer of clear varnish to your terracotta jewellery to protect it from moisture and enhance its durability.
  • If you notice any cracks or damage on your terracotta jewellery, it is best to consult a professional jeweler who specializes in terracotta repairs.
